Press: "Man Utd" faces competition in the battle for B. Fernandes (updated)

In the Spanish media, quite sensational news spread on Tuesday.

"Superdeporte" and "Mundo Deportivo" report that "Barcelona" has finished negotiations with Lisbon's "Sporting" for the acquisition of Bruno Fernandes.

It is announced that "Barcelona" will lend the Portuguese to "Valencia" for half a year, while allowing the Catalans to call the forward Rodrigo until the end of the season.

It is believed that "Barca" agreed to pay 80 million euros for the Portuguese, which allowed the negotiations to be quickly concluded.

B. Fernandes has been linked with a move to "Man Utd" throughout January, but the deal did not go through as the English club refused to pay the amount requested by "Sporting."

The 25-year-old Portuguese scored 15 goals in 28 matches this season.

However, the media in Portugal and England contradicted their colleagues from Spain - it is claimed that "Man Utd" has not yet withdrawn from the battle.

According to "Sky Sports," the Manchester club has presented a new offer that brings B. Fernandes closer to a move to England. The amount discussed is around 55 million euros with possible bonuses.
